Four Kings becomes cake if you use Iron Flesh and pound them with ranged stuff.

Ceaseless Discharge is a sort of gimmicky boss, though not the worst one (fucking Bed of Chaos). His vision is mostly based on motion, so when he rounds the corner hold still until he's right in front of you, and then run into the little valley about 2/3rds of the way through. He'll throw his bone thing at you, run back as not to get hit, and then whail on it.

Or if you get him to go all the way back to the fog gate, you can get him to fall down a bottomless pit. Not even joking. Just whack his hand when he grabs on to the ledge.
